同时管理多个数据库可以通过以下几种方式实现:
- 数据库复制:数据库复制是一种将数据从一个数据库复制到另一个数据库的技术。通过数据库复制,可以实现多个数据库之间的数据同步和备份。常见的数据库复制技术包括主从复制和多主复制。主从复制中,一个数据库作为主数据库,负责写操作,其他数据库作为从数据库,负责读操作。多主复制中,多个数据库都可以进行读写操作。
- 数据库集群:数据库集群是将多个数据库服务器组成一个集群,共同提供数据库服务。数据库集群可以通过分布式架构实现数据的分片和负载均衡,提高数据库的性能和可用性。常见的数据库集群技术包括MySQL Cluster、MongoDB Sharding、Redis Cluster等。
- 数据库中间件:数据库中间件是位于应用程序和数据库之间的一层软件,用于管理和协调多个数据库的访问。数据库中间件可以提供连接池、负载均衡、故障切换、缓存等功能,简化应用程序对数据库的操作。常见的数据库中间件包括MySQL Proxy、TencentDB Proxy等。
- 数据库管理工具:数据库管理工具是一种用于管理和监控多个数据库的软件。通过数据库管理工具,可以对多个数据库进行统一的配置、监控和维护。常见的数据库管理工具包括Navicat、DBeaver、phpMyAdmin等。
以上是同时管理多个数据库的几种常见方式,具体选择哪种方式取决于实际需求和场景。腾讯云提供了多个与数据库相关的产品和服务,包括云数据库 TencentDB、数据库中间件 TencentDB Proxy、数据库备份与恢复 TencentDB for Redis等。您可以根据具体需求选择适合的产品和服务。更多详情请参考腾讯云数据库产品介绍页面:https://cloud.tencent.com/product/cdb